The role

SSE Thermal have two Lead Engineer positions available at Medway Power Station - Rotating Plant Engineer and Balance of Plant Engineer. These openings offer a unique opportunity to join our business and help us on our mission to deliver the flexible energy needed today while powering the transition to net zero.

Reporting to the Engineering Manager, the Lead Engineer – Rotating Equipment, will be responsible for the power station rotating assets including two GE 9FA gas turbines and a D11 steam turbine.

You will

- Deliver an effective outage strategy and management of outages, optimising the planned maintenance strategy to meet with the needs of our stakeholders to maximise reliability and minimise plant downtime.

- Provide technical expertise and advice to other departments in relation to rotating plant, with emphasis on maximising efficiency, plant performance and safety.

- Provide technical governance, compliance with industry best practice and delivery of engineering solutions for rotating plant assets.

- Be responsible for budget ownership and contract management of key strategic suppliers and management of our rotating equipment contract partners.

These accountabilities are in relation to the rotating plant mechanical assets of the power station.

You have

- Experience within a similar role in the electricity, or an equivalent engineering industry and experience of working with gas and steam turbines.

- Extensive engineering knowledge in relation to gas turbines and steam turbines and familiar with the types of systems and equipment used in power generation.

- Educated to degree level or equivalent in an engineering discipline or equivalent relevant working experience.

- Excellent communication skills and ability to successfully manage teams and outages.

- A good knowledge of Health and Safety legislation and regulations in relation to mechanical systems and a passion for safety and successful delivery against key stakeholder requirements.
